In addition to helping you set a astute asking price to attract more potential buyers, a professional appraisal can:

  • Be a very helpful bargaining tool while speaking with a potential buyer
  • Put buyers at ease with written proof of your home's condition inside and out
  • Alert you of problems and get rid of any overlooked repairs hassles that might stall a closing
  • Help decrease the possibility of hidden problems that cause sales to flop

People are surprised when they find out that their home's value is more than they originally believed. So investing in a professional appraisal provided the data to support a sale for several thousand more than they thought they would get. Others have an an overestimated opinion of the value of their home, and an appraisal gave then the assistance they needed in order to set a more reasonable price their home in order for it to sell quickly instead of waiting on the market for months. An overpriced home will not attract buyers, reducing your offers, making closing more difficult, which can waste your valuable time and drain your resources while getting nothing done
